? How CBDCs and Stablecoins Supercharge Global Payments ?

CBDCs are digital forms of central bank money, while stablecoins are cryptocurrencies pegged to stable assets like the US dollar or euro. Together, they offer a new payments infrastructure with speed, security, and low cost at its core. McKinsey describes stablecoins as “tokenized cash using blockchain technology” that allow payments to settle globally fast and transparently-removing the bottlenecks of legacy systems relying on banking hours and intermediaries[1].

Imagine sending $100 to a friend or supplier overseas. Traditional wire transfers charge $25-$50 fees and can take days. Stablecoins can reduce these costs to just pennies and settle anytime-even weekends-because they’re operating on blockchain rails[2]. Moreover, CBDCs, backed by central banks, promise the stability and trust of fiat money combined with digital convenience. Juniper Research estimates that by 2031, global payments using CBDCs will explode, reaching 7.8 billion transactions annually, up from a mere 300 million in 2024[3].

What this means practically is a massive leap in cross-border business, remittances, and treasury management efficiencies, potentially saving billions of dollars annually while including underserved populations in the formal economy.


? Why Investors Should Pinpoint This Moment for Crypto Market Insights ?

Since stablecoins are issued mostly in US dollars (like USDC), they function as a bridge between traditional finance and crypto assets. This evolves how money flows in financial markets and how crypto assets themselves gain utility beyond speculation. When the majority of customers start holding funds in stablecoins, it changes the demand for underlying fiat reserves and funding models for banks[1].

This dynamic intertwines closely with crypto exchanges and decentralized finance (DeFi) platforms that use stablecoins as trading pairs, collateral, and liquidity pools. An uptick in stablecoin volume-currently about $30 billion daily but set to grow exponentially-serves as a barometer for crypto market health and adoption[1][4].

Moreover, increased regulatory clarity, like the US GENIUS Act and EU’s MiCA framework, is transforming stablecoins from “crypto wild west” instruments to recognized payment tools[2][5]. This boosts institutional confidence and could drive further integration of stablecoins into mainstream finance, thereby stimulating adjacent crypto sectors.


? Challenges and Risks in the New Digital Payment Era

While the horizon looks bright, adoption isn’t without hurdles. Stablecoins require abundant liquidity and reliable off-ramps to convert back to fiat currencies, still dependent on legacy infrastructure[1]. There’s also a risk of overhyping stablecoins as cure-alls; some experts caution against spinning a narrative that enrolls stablecoins as solutions to every problem in payments[4].

CBDCs, by nature, raise privacy concerns, and countries vary in their approaches. For example, China leads with retail and wholesale CBDCs designed to extend governmental control, while the Eurozone focuses on safeguarding monetary sovereignty through the digital euro[5].

Understanding these nuances is crucial for investors weighing long-term exposure to crypto enterprises and blockchain payment platforms. The evolving regulatory and geopolitical landscape will shape winners and losers.
